Others have tried harder to define it (spyware, not pornography). Barwinski et
al. (2006) have said it has four characteristics. First, it hides, so the victim cannot
find it easily.
Second, it collects data about the user (Websites visited, passwords,
even credit card numbers).
Third, it communicates the collected information back
to its distant master. And fourth, it tries to survive determined attempts to remove
it. Additionally, some spyware changes settings and performs other malicious and
annoying activities as described below.
Barwinsky et al. divided the spyware into three broad categories. The first is
marketing: the spyware simply collects information and sends it back to the master,
usually to better target advertising to specific machines. The second category is
surveillance, where companies intentionally put spyware on employee machines to
keep track of what they are doing and which Websites they are visiting. The third
gets close to classical malware, where the infected machine becomes part of a
zombie army waiting for its master to give it marching orders.
They ran an experiment to see what kinds of Websites contain spyware by vis-
iting 5000 Websites. They observed that the major purveyors of spyware are Web-
sites relating to adult entertainment, warez, online travel, and real estate.
A much larger study was done at the University of Washington (Moshchuk et
al., 2006).
In the UW study, some 18 million URLs were inspected and almost 6%
were found to contain spyware. Thus it is not surprising that in a study by
AOL/NCSA that they cite, 80% of the home computers inspected were infested by
spyware, with an average of 93 pieces of spyware per computer. The UW study
found that the adult, celebrity, and wallpaper sites had the largest infection rates,
but they did not examine travel and real estate.
How Spyware Spreads
The obvious next question is: ‘‘How does a computer get infected with spy-
ware?’’ One way is the same as with any malware: via a Trojan horse.
A consid-
erable amount of free software contains spyware, with the author of the software
making money from the spyware. Peer-to-peer file-sharing software (e.g., Kazaa)
is rampant with spyware. Also, many Websites display banner ads that direct
surfers to spyware-infested Web pages.
The other major infection route is often called the
drive-by download
. It is
possible to pick up spyware (in fact, any malware) just by visiting an infected Web
page. There are three variants of the infection technology.
First, the Web page may
redirect the browser to an executable (
.exe
) file. When the browser sees the file, it
pops up a dialog box asking the user if he wants to run or save the program. Since
legitimate downloads use the same mechanism, most users just click on RUN,
